2002 Alfa Romeo 156 vs. 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ider

To start off, 2002 Alfa Romeo 156 is newer by 39 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ider would be higher. At 2,580 cc (6 cylinders), 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Alfa Romeo 156 (189 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 26 more horse power than 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ider. (163 HP @ 5900 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2002 Alfa Romeo 156 should accelerate faster than 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2002 Alfa Romeo 156 weights approximately 75 kg more than 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ider (220 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 2 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Alfa Romeo 156. (218 Nm @ 5000 RPM). This means 1963 Alfa Romeo Spider will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Alfa Romeo 156.
